麻豆黑色丝袜jk制服福利网站-麻豆精品传媒视频观看-麻豆精品传媒一二三区在线视频-麻豆精选传媒4区2021-在线视频99-在线视频a

千鋒教育-做有情懷、有良心、有品質的職業教育機構

手機站
千鋒教育

千鋒學習站 | 隨時隨地免費學

千鋒教育

掃一掃進入千鋒手機站

領取全套視頻
千鋒教育

關注千鋒學習站小程序
隨時隨地免費學習課程

當前位置:首頁  >  千鋒問答  > 線程安全是什么意思
線程安全是什么意思
匿名提問者 2023-04-18 15:41:48

推薦答案

  線程安全(Thread safety)是指在多線程編程中,一個程序或者代碼段在并發訪問時,能夠正確地保持其預期的行為和狀態,而不會出現意外的錯誤或者不一致的結果。

  在多線程編程中,多個線程可以同時訪問共享的資源,如共享變量、共享數據結構、共享文件等。由于多線程的并發執行性質,可能會導致多個線程同時讀寫共享資源,從而引發各種并發訪問的問題,如競態條件(Race Condition)、死鎖(Deadlock)、饑餓(Starvation)等。線程安全的編程技術和方法旨在解決這些并發訪問問題,確保在多線程環境中程序能夠正確地運行。

線程安全是什么意思

  實現線程安全的方式通常包括使用互斥鎖(Mutex)、信號量(Semaphore)、條件變量(Condition Variable)等同步機制來對共享資源進行保護,以確保在同一時間只有一個線程可以訪問共享資源,從而避免并發訪問問題。此外,還可以使用無鎖(Lock-free)的數據結構和算法,或者使用并發編程模型,如消息傳遞(Message Passing)等方式來實現線程安全。

  線程安全對于多線程編程非常重要,因為在并發環境中,如果代碼不是線程安全的,可能會導致程序產生不一致的結果、崩潰、死鎖等嚴重問題。因此,在進行多線程編程時,需要特別注意并發訪問問題,并采取合適的線程安全策略和方法來確保程序的正確性和穩定性。

主站蜘蛛池模板: 国产剧果冻传媒星空在线播放| 欧美精品国产综合久久| 日本中文字幕第一页| 亚洲欧美一二三区| 美女张开腿让男人真实视频| 国产悠悠视频在线播放| 欧美夫妇交换俱乐部在线观看| 欧美精品一区二区三区在线| 欧美妈妈的朋友| 男女无遮挡猛进猛出免费观看视频 | 波多野结衣大战三个黑鬼| 免费国产va在线观看视频| 男人j进美女p动态图片| 翁想房中春意浓1-28| 又爽又黄又无遮挡的视频| 三级毛片在线| 美女扒开胸罩| 国产综合色在线视频区| 国产馆在线观看| 色悠久久久久综合欧美99| 扒开女人下面| 美团外卖猛男男同38分钟| 国产破外女出血视频| 黄a在线观看| heyzo小向美奈子在线| 狠狠色噜噜狠狠狠合久| 全彩无翼口工漫画大全3d| 精品伊人久久大线蕉地址| 国产精品高清一区二区三区 | 妇色妇荡| 又湿又紧又大又爽a视频| 欧美性大战久久久久久久| 美女张开腿让男人真实视频| 国产丰满岳乱妇在线观看| 欧美午夜伦y4480私人影院| 国产一区二区在线观看app| 欧美亚洲一二三区| 冬日恋歌国语版20集中文版| 里番牝教师~淫辱yy608| 黄网站色视频免费观看| 果冻传媒第一第二第三集|